Today, the Parliament approved the bill on “Preventing domestic violence and restoring family cohesion” on the second reading and in complete form with 75 for, 12 against votes. 12 members of parliament abstained from voting. Yelk and ARF voted for the bill. RPA and Tsarukyan Alliance had a free vote. The legislative body approved on the second reading also the bills concerning budgetary system and state debt. Four economic projects have been discussed on the first reading today. For written offers and the conclusion of the committee, three hours are required. The Parliament interrupted today’s session. The extraordinary session will continue tomorrow.
